In the context of primary xylem, the arrangement where protoxylem lies towards the periphery and metaxylem towards the center is termed "exarch". This arrangement is characteristic of:

0 views 0 helpful Updated Jul 20, 2026
Solution ✔ Verified
  • AStems.
  • BLeaves.
  • CRoots.
  • DFlowers.
Explanation

In roots, the protoxylem (first-formed xylem) lies towards the periphery and metaxylem (later-formed xylem) towards the center, an arrangement termed exarch. In stems, it's endarch.
